What is a Mobile Locksmith for Cars?
A [mobile locksmith for cars](https://chsp.hispanichealth.info/members/reportprint23/activity/84377/) is a professional who focuses on automotive locksmith services. Unlike traditional locksmiths who have a fixed place, mobile locksmiths travel to the customer's area. This makes them a perfect option for emergency scenarios where time is of the essence. Mobile locksmith professionals are equipped with a variety of tools and proficiency to handle a wide variety of key-related issues, from easy key extractions to intricate key programming for modern cars.

Key Programming
Transponder Keys: Many modern vehicles use transponder keys, which have a chip that communicates with the car's computer. Mobile locksmiths can program these keys to ensure they work properly.Remote Key Fobs: In addition to physical keys, remote key fobs are frequently used to lock and unlock cars and trucks. A mobile locksmith can program these fobs to operate with your vehicle.

How long does it consider a mobile locksmith to arrive?
The reaction time can vary depending on the business and your place, however numerous mobile locksmiths aim to get here within 30 minutes to an hour.
Do mobile locksmiths work on all kinds of cars?
Yes, most mobile locksmith professionals are geared up to handle a variety of lorries, including cars, trucks, SUVs, and motorcycles. They are also trained to deal with various makes and designs.
Is it legal to call a mobile locksmith?
Yes, it is legal to call a mobile locksmith. However, it's important to verify their credentials and ensure they are certified and insured.
Can mobile locksmith professionals make keys for modern-day cars with chips?
Yes, numerous mobile locksmith professionals can program transponder keys and remote key fobs for contemporary lorries. They utilize customized devices to guarantee the keys work correctly.
